Summary:

As a valued member of the distribution team, the primary objective for this position is to safely and accurately ensure the correct product is sent to Cengage Learning customers.

Position Description:

You will be responsible for safely performing all duties associated with the systematic and manual picking and packing of customer orders.

Essential Duties/Responsibilities:

  • You will determine the correct box size to be used to pack orders.

  • Utilize sight recognition and matching of alpha and numeric listings to ensure accurate orders are shipped to customers.

  • You will pack individual units into boxes.

  • You will use the voice directed system “Jennifer” to make sure the appropriate ISBN is packed and following standards to ensure product is not damaged during shipment.

  • You will enter information into LogPro system.

  • Continuously reach, lift, push and pull up to 40 lbs. to return individual units to appropriate locations.

  • Safely lift, push, pull and relocate packages up to 50 lbs. as required.

  • Be committed to the team effort.

  • You will cross-train in various departments within the distribution center.

  • You will also have other duties as assigned.

Skills/Knowledge/Experience:

Required:

  • At least 16 years of age.

  • Skilled in site recognition/matching of numeric and alpha groupings.

  • Able to comprehend simple instructions.

  • You should have the skillset to write legibly.

  • You will have the opportunity to exhibit your add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division skills.

  • Be flexible with work hours.

  • Basic computer experience.

  • Stand and walk for 8-10 hours.

  • Follow all safety practices and policies.

Preferred:

  • Prior RF experience.

  • Prior distribution experience.
